1  Warhammer Dark Omen / Tactics / Re: Power of Anti Magic Items and Dispell Magic on: October 02, 2009, 07:19:41 PM
From singleplayer I have learned that all antimagic defence could be avoided or negated sometimes. On last battle I was having fun, and mummies obtained antimagic banner. After all I killed them with thunder storm banner, less effective, but about 25% of hits find their target. Interesting that banner negates and even sometimes negates direct magic attacks. It could turn back fireball from gunderbringer sword and mage's fireball, but never thunder from banner or sword. Negates - yes, but never turn back.
Also I had beed hit with enemy necromancer when 3 dispell magic were on the regiment.

But as I noticed not only antimagic stuff (casts from mages, shield or banner and trools) have some sort of small chanse being penetrated, but also shiled of ptolos. I can devide it in 3 categories:
a) regiments with ptolos hit by a cannon or orc bolt. From my small experience chances to loose some units are about 50%/50%
b) regiments with ptolos hit by a mortar / lobber / cataput (direct hit has 50% chances of penetrating and making damage, indirect about 10%)
c) regiments with ptolos hit by archers. While your regiment stay silent - almost 100% safe. When your regiment move there a slim chance to been hit appears, and when your regiment shoot back or fight in cc another regiment - more chances apperas for being hit.
Tested in 3-rd part of a singleplayer (frosen land) when I tried to shoot all archers and catapult with my own x-men with ptolos.

And as I understood all anti stuff works well with 1 thread. When I try to hit regiment with ptolos with 2 regiment of archers it start taking huge damage. Same with magic.
